How Do HEPA and Activated Carbon Filters Enhance Air Quality?

Activated carbon filters operate by a process called adsorption, where pollutants adhere to the surface of the activated carbon material. This is particularly useful for eliminating odors from cooking, pets, and smoke, as well as harmful chemicals found in household cleaners and building materials, thus enhancing the air quality in homes and offices.

What Are Common Misconceptions About Air Purifiers and Their Effectiveness?

Common misconceptions about air purifiers can lead to misunderstandings regarding their effectiveness and proper usage.

  • Air purifiers eliminate all indoor air pollutants: Many people believe that air purifiers can remove all types of airborne contaminants, including bacteria, viruses, and allergens. However, while they can significantly reduce particulate matter and certain pollutants, they may not be effective against all pathogens or gases unless specifically designed for those purposes.
  • More expensive air purifiers are always better: There is a common belief that higher-priced air purifiers automatically provide superior performance. In reality, the best air purifier for a specific space depends on factors such as the type of filtration technology it uses, the size of the room, and the specific pollutants one wishes to target, rather than just the price tag.
  • All air purifiers require constant filter replacement: Some users think that every air purifier requires frequent filter changes, leading to ongoing maintenance costs. However, certain models, particularly those with HEPA filters, can operate effectively for several months or even years before needing a replacement, depending on usage and environmental conditions.
  • Running an air purifier is enough for clean air: A common misconception is that using an air purifier alone ensures clean indoor air. While air purifiers are effective at reducing airborne particles, they should be part of a broader strategy that includes proper ventilation, regular cleaning, and minimizing sources of indoor pollution.
  • Air purifiers are only necessary during allergy season: Many individuals mistakenly believe that air purifiers are only beneficial when allergens are at their peak. In reality, air purifiers can provide year-round assistance by continuously filtering out dust, pet dander, smoke, and other pollutants, improving overall indoor air quality at all times.
